Half Field Transition and Shooting

Summary

This drill works on clearing passes and transition opportunities. You can do this on 1 end of the field, or set up in both ends, but working independently.

Set Up

Put 2 Attack players on the crease, a line of defense at the lower retraining line, and a line of midfielders at the opposite far side midfield line. There will be a goalie in the low corner, or at X with the balls. The drill starts with the goalie passing a ball to a defender. When the defender receives the ball, they will start moving up field, and a midfielder form the opposite sit will cut towards their teammate to receive a pass. We want the midfielder to catch and pass the ball quickly to the lower attack player curing for the ball. The attack will make 1 pass, and finish with a shot. Simultaneously, the midfielder will continue cutting to the goal to receive a pass from the Goalie/Coach for a transition shot.

Coaching Points and Principles

  • Clearing and Long passes – Make sure we are moving our feet!
  • Players receiving the passes, cut and move to the ball
  • Shooting – Finish with an inside shot from the attacker, and a shot on the run or step down from the midfield

Progressions

  • Add in 2 defense the drill covering the attackmen. After the midfielder gets the pass, they will come down and play a 3v2
